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) women MPs on Tuesday supported Lok Sabha Speaker Om Birla while criticising Opposition MPs over the alleged “unfortunate incident” during the Motion of Thanks discussion on the President’s Address. 

The BJP MPs wrote to the Speaker alleging that Opposition women MPs surrounded the Prime Minister’s seat and later aggressively approached the Speaker’s chamber on February



4. They urged him to take the strongest possible action against those involved.

In their letter, BJP MPs said Opposition members entered the Well of the House, climbed on tables, tore papers and threw them towards the Chair.

They added they felt deeply provoked but refrained from reacting on instructions from senior leaders, calling it one of the darkest moments in parliamentary democracy.
